How do I know if I am drinking enough water? Your body has a handy way of letting you know when you aren’t drinking enough: thirst. If you spend most of the day without being thirsty, your water intake is already sufficient. You can also check the color of your urine.

The US National Academies of Sciences, Engineering, and Medicine recommends about 15.5 8 oz. cups of fluid daily for an adult male and about 11.5 8 oz. cups of fluid for an adult female. Web25 jun. 2024 · Cattle tend to increase water intake as temperature rise, with 27°C being the temperature where marked changes in water intake are noted (Table 1). This may be attributed to the animal’s need to dissipate body heat and/or the reduced feed intake (by 30% or more) under heat stress and the animal’s need to maintain the sensation of gut …
